About Cooley Ranch Elementary

Cooley Ranch Elementary School in Colton, California, is a public elementary school serving students from kindergarten through grade 6. There are about 505 students at the school, and there is one teacher for every 24 students. Cooley Ranch Elementary School teaches according to California's state curriculum standards, with an emphasis on reading, writing, math, science and social studies. The school also puts a lot of emphasis on creating supportive classroom environments and programs that encourage students to get involved and do well in school. According to the academic performance data about 26% of students are good at math and about 32% are good at reading. Many of the students at the school come from minority and bilingual families, which shows how diverse the Colton community is. English language development programs and targeted academic help for students who need it are common parts of instructional strategies. Cooley Ranch Elementary School wants to help all students learn and grow academically while also creating a welcoming and diverse learning environment.
